Buying Guide: Choosing Your RV Projector
Connectivity and Smart Features
Seamless connection is paramount in an RV. Look for projectors with dual-band WiFi (2.4G/5G) and the latest Bluetooth standards, like 5.2 or 5.4, for stable streaming and audio pairing. Built-in apps or Android OS eliminate the need for extra dongles, letting you launch content directly.
Models like the Aurzen Roku TV D1R Smart Portable Outdoor come with a full streaming platform built-in. Others support easy screen mirroring from iOS and Android devices. This versatility is key for family trips where everyone uses different gadgets.
Portability and Power Options
Space is always at a premium. A compact, lightweight design is non-negotiable. Many models we reviewed weigh under a pound and are smaller than a hardcover book. Also, consider power flexibility. Some projectors support Type-C power input, which can be a game-changer for off-grid use with portable power stations.
This portability makes them perfect not just for the RV, but for setting up an outdoor screen by the picnic table. For other compact living situations, check out our picks for the top Smartphone-Compatible projectors for small rooms.
Image Quality and Setup Ease
<!–You don’t need cinema-grade gear, but good clarity matters. Native 1080P resolution is a sweet spot for sharp detail. Features like auto focus and auto keystone correction are invaluable in an RV. They instantly give you a perfectly rectangular, focused image, even if the projector is placed on an uneven surface.
A short-throw ratio is another major benefit. It allows you to project a large image from a short distance, ideal for the limited wall space inside your RV. This means you can enjoy a big picture without rearranging your entire living area.
Audio and Versatility
<!–Built-in speakers save you from packing extra gear. Look for stereo speakers or Dolby Audio support for a more immersive experience. For private viewing or louder sound, Bluetooth connectivity to headphones or a portable speaker is essential.
Additional features like a 180-degree rotatable base or ceiling mount option offer incredible flexibility. You can project onto a wall, a makeshift screen, or even the ceiling from your bunk. This adaptability is what makes these devices so perfect for life on the move.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use these projectors without an internet connection in my RV?
Yes, absolutely. While WiFi is needed for streaming apps, you can pre-download movies or shows to your smartphone and use screen mirroring. Alternatively, load content onto a USB drive and play it directly through the projector’s USB port. This makes them perfect for boondocking or areas with poor cell service.
Do all smartphone-compatible projectors work with Netflix and Disney+?
Due to copyright protection (HDCP), wireless screen mirroring often blocks video from major streaming apps. The most reliable method is to use a TV stick (like Roku or Fire Stick) connected via HDMI. Some projectors, like those with built-in Android TV or Roku, have the apps certified to work directly, which is the simplest solution. How bright does an RV projector need to be?
For use inside a darkened RV at night, you don’t need extreme brightness. Models rated between 200 to 300 ANSI lumens are typically sufficient. The key is controlling ambient light. For occasional use in a partially lit space or a sheltered outdoor setup, a higher lumen rating will provide a better image. Remember, a higher number generally means a more viewable picture in less-than-ideal lighting.
What is the advantage of a projector over a portable TV for an RV?
The primary advantage is screen size and storage. A projector can create a screen up to 200 inches diagonally, then pack down to the size of a coffee mug. It offers a true cinematic experience that a small portable TV cannot match. It’s also more versatile, easily switching from indoor use to an outdoor backyard movie setup at the campsite.
